Rome, Gian Bernini, And Water Features
Rome, Gian Bernini, And Water Features There are countless celebrated water features in Rome’s city center. One of the greatest sculptors and designers of the 17th century, Gian Lorenzo Bernini designed, conceived and constructed nearly all of them. His expertise as a water feature designer and also as a city designer, are evident all through the avenues of Rome. To fully express their art, chiefly in the form of community water features and water features, Bernini's father, a renowned Florentine sculptor, mentored his young son, and they eventually relocated in Rome.
An excellent employee, the young Bernini earned compliments and the backing of many popes and influential designers. He was originally celebrated for his sculpture. An authority in historical Greek engineering, he used this knowledge as a platform and melded it gracefully with Roman marble, most notably in the Vatican. Though many artists had an impact on his work, Michelangelo had the most profound effect.

The Magificent Early Masterpieces by Bernini
The Magificent Early Masterpieces by Bernini The Barcaccia, a beautiful water fountain built at the base of the Trinita dei Monti in Piaza di Spagna, was Bernini's earliest fountain. To this day, this spot is flooded with Roman locals and tourists alike who enjoy conversation and each other's company.
One of the city’s most fashionable meeting spots are the streets surrounding Bernini's fountain, which would undoubtedly have brought a smile to the great Bernini. The master's very first fountain of his professional life was built at around 1630 at the request of Pope Urbano VIII. People can now see the fountain as a depiction of a commanding ship slowly sinking into the Mediterranean. Period writings dating back to the 16th century indicate that the fountain was constructed as a memorial to those who lost their lives in the great flooding of the Tevere.
